Hello everyone,
after installing a new version of wordpress on my new server and importing a friends blog on this server via wordpress import I am experiencing now a strange error when trying to save the OPTIONS in SETTINGS/GENERAL. It won’t save.
URL: caseycordes.com
Here is the error
Forbidden
You don’t have permission to access /wp-admin/options.php on this server.
Additionally, a 404 Not Found error was encountered while trying to use an ErrorDocument to handle the request.
I’ve tried to add various mod rewrites under the .htaccess file, that I was searching in google. However non of these rewrites worked. They did stopped the error, however wouldn’t save the settings, just open more php files in the URL.
Hope someone can help.

Many hosts experienced problems due to mass attacks recently and some disabled access to wp-admin and/or wp-login.php as a temporary precaution. I’m wondering if your hosts is one of them…
I have experienced this several times and it has always been related to missing files. If you save your theme and upload a fresh version of WP it will resolve this issues.
